FORTEL GROUP is the UK's largest national supplier of agency labor staff to the construction sector, offering high volumes and a very fast response across all labor, trades, and professional fields. They are also the sole provider of external and internal concrete floors and have been recognized by Deloitte's Futures 1000 as one of the country's best-performing businesses.

Role Description

This is a full-time on-site role for an Overhead Linesman located in Glasgow. The Overhead Linesman will be responsible for tasks related to electricity, power distribution, CDL Class A, heavy equipment, and substations.

Qualifications

  • Electricity and Power Distribution skills
  • CDL Class A and Heavy Equipment operation
  • Substation knowledge
  • Experience in working in a construction environment
  • Excellent problem-solving skills
  • Strong attention to detail
  • Ability to work at heights and in varying weather conditions
  • Relevant certifications or licenses
